ptr Posted April 29 Posted April 29 Here's a release on the announcement: The top high school defensive coordinator in North Carolina is the new head football coach at Bloomington North. Former Cougar lineman Andy Harding was lured back from Tarboro, NC and it's ultra-successful program to take over at his alma mater and was officially approved at the MCCSC board meeting on Tuesday, April 28. Harding takes over for Brett Cooper, who left after one season to take over at Class 6A powerhouse Ben Davis. Harding will be the third coach in three years for the Cougars following Scott Bless' retirement. North still went 15-7 the past two seasons. Quote
